753 FGUS85 KLKN 132208 RVSLKN NVC007-011-013-015-141200- Hydrologic Statement National Weather Service Elko NV 308 PM PDT Mon May 13 2024 ...Warm temperatures this week will lead to increased runoff and higher flows in area creeks and rivers... High elevation snow pack continues to accelerate this week as temperatures remain in the 70s and 80s during the day with overnight lows in the 40s and possibly 50s. Low temperatures at higher elevations where snowpack remains may not fall below freezing for the next several nights. With the increased runoff, area rivers and creeks will see enhanced flows. Some of these include Salmon Falls Creek near San Jacinto, the Humboldt River at Comus and Battle Mountain, South Fork Humboldt River at South Fork Dam and Dixie Creek, the Owyhee River at Wildhorse and Mountain City, Bruneau River at Rowland, Marys River at Charleston, Lamoille Creek, Marys River at Deeth, and Jarbidge River at Jarbidge. When river gauge water levels reach action stage or higher, additional hydrologic products will be issued at that time. Outdoor enthusiasts should use caution as the water is very cold and a person could be swept away by the fast flowing water. $$
